Course Details

• Understanding Eating Disorders: Definition, Prevalence, and Types
• Informed Consent: Legal and Ethical Considerations
• Building Therapeutic Relationships: Cultural Competence and Empathy
• Assessment and Diagnostic Tools for Eating Disorders
• Treatment Modalities for Eating Disorders: Evidence-Based Practices
• Informed Consent Process in Eating Disorder Treatment: Best Practices
• Navigating Confidentiality and Information Sharing in Eating Disorder Treatment
• Special Considerations in Informed Consent for Adolescent and Minor Patients
• Documentation and Record Keeping in Informed Consent for Eating Disorders
• Addressing Common Barriers and Challenges in Informed Consent for Eating Disorders

Career Path

In the UK, the demand for professionals equipped with a Global Certificate in Eating Disorders: Informed Consent Practices is on the rise. Here's a breakdown of the prominent roles in this field and their market trends, represented by a 3D pie chart: 1. **Clinical Psychologist**: Making up 35% of the market, clinical psychologists diagnose and treat various mental health disorders, including eating disorders. 2. **Registered Dietitian**: Comprising 25% of the sector, registered dietitians focus on diet and nutrition as crucial factors in mental and physical well-being. 3. **Mental Health Nurse**: With 20% of the market share, mental health nurses offer comprehensive care for individuals managing eating disorders. 4. **Counselor/Therapist**: Covering 15% of the industry, counselors and therapists provide essential emotional support and guidance for patients. 5. **Social Worker**: Though only representing 5% of the market, social workers contribute significantly by helping families and patients navigate the challenges of living with eating disorders. By understanding these trends, professionals can make informed decisions about their career paths in this crucial and growing field.
